So, this was something that required a great amount of skill and a little bit of luck to pull off. The Rebels' attack would have been doomed had it not been for Luke Skywalker using the Force to guide a proton torpedo down the exhaust port. It wasn't until 2016's Rogue One when an official, in-canon explanation was given: Galen Erso sabotaged the Death Star during its development.Įven with Galen's assist, blowing up the Death Star wasn't an easy task. For years, it was perceived as a sign of the Empire's hubris, illustrating they underestimated any who dared oppose them. Audiences had a hard time believing the well-resourced Empire would let such an obvious design flaw (a thermal exhaust port right below the main port) slip past them. Ever since A New Hope premiered in 1977, the Death Star's weakness has been one of the film's most-discussed talking points.
